sometimes creating a file (using different programs) fails with the
error message "No buffer space available". This is on amd64_linux26
with OpenAFS 1.6.2 (both client and server). Any idea?
I don't see anywhere we'd be generating that error code (ENOBUFS), and I
can't see how it would show up that way if we got it back from a socket
or something. Do you have any idea if the machine is under a lot of load
or memory pressure, or if the directory has a lot of entries in it?
The client was not under heavy load, but the fileserver, and the network.
